A free appropriate touch social story is a story that aims to teach about appropriate touch in a social context. It helps people, especially children or those with special needs, understand what kind of touch is okay, like a friendly hug from a family member or a high - five from a friend, and what is not okay, such as unwanted rough handling.
To use a free appropriate touch social story effectively, first, ensure that the target audience can relate to the characters and situations in the story. If it's for children, use child - friendly language and scenarios. Second, encourage active participation. After reading the story, ask questions like 'What would you do in this situation?' This helps in internalizing the concepts. Third, use visual aids if possible. If the story mentions a hug, show pictures of different types of hugs (side hug, full hug) and discuss which are more appropriate in different situations. This multi - faceted approach makes the story more impactful.

A 'good touch bad touch social story' is a crucial tool in child protection. It is about making children understand the difference between good and bad touches. Good touches are consensual, gentle, and come from a place of love or respect, like a high - five from a teammate. Bad touches are any form of touch that makes a child feel scared, uneasy, or violated, for example, if a stranger tries to touch a child inappropriately. This type of story empowers children to recognize these situations and know how to respond, whether it's by saying 'no' or telling a trusted adult.
One way to use 'good touch bad touch social story' effectively is to personalize it for the kids. If it's in a classroom setting, relate it to the children's daily interactions at school. For example, talk about how a good touch can be when a teacher gives a sticker on the hand for good work, and a bad touch could be if someone pushes them too hard on the playground. Another important aspect is to follow up the story with real - life examples and discussions. Let the kids talk about what they think are good and bad touches in their own lives. And always emphasize that if they ever experience a bad touch, they should immediately tell a trusted adult like a parent or a teacher.
